guys pleASE help me out with this question-two vessels contain spirit and water mixed respectively in the ratio 1:3 and 3:5. Find the ratio in which these are to be mixed to get a new mixture in which the ratio of spirit to water is 1:2?
1:2?
let quantity in vessel I be x
..............................II be y
quantity of spirit taken from vessel I = 1/4x
quantity of water taken from vessel I = 3/4x

quantity of spirit taken from vessel II = 3/8y
quantity of water taken from vessel II = 5/8y

total quantity of spirit in new mix = (1/4x+3/8y)
total quantity of water in new mix = (3/4x+5/8y)

ratio of this is equal to 1:2

so..(1/4*x+3/8*y)/(3/4*x+5/8*y)=1/2
x/y=1/2@vishcat

In a triangle ABC, AD , BE ,AND CF are internal angle bisectors of the angles A,B AND C respectively . if D divides BC in the ratio 1:2 and E divides AC in the ratio 3:4, what is the ratio in which F divides AB? PLEASE HELP
Let BC=3x and AC=7y
Now AB/7y = 1/2 =>AB/y=7/2
And AB/3x=3/4=>AB/x=9/4

So divide one by the other and get y/x = 9/14
Now AF/FB = 7y/3x = (7/3)(9/14) = 3/2
Hence 3:2

@vishcat said:
@catahead i am asking about that (3/8-1/3)/(1/3-1/4) ....
So the proportion in 1st is 1/4 and in second is 3/8 and we need to use the property of alligation to get 1/4
So 1/4___________3/8
_________1/3_________
(3/8-1/3)______(1/3-1/4)
The ratio of the last 2 terms is 1:2
